Transaction 34ced7765b030932e8022e903f267676d530b541c07e2be7a4979ef3135e4da0

1 Input
2 Outputs
  • 34ced7765b030932e8022e903f267676d530b541c07e2be7a4979ef3135e4da0:0
  • value  1000000
    address  2N8hwP1WmJrFF5QWABn38y63uYLhnJYJYTF
  • 34ced7765b030932e8022e903f267676d530b541c07e2be7a4979ef3135e4da0:1
  • value  40996016
    address  2MuWdFXjRLX8xzUcYsXyDCRnGcaQ1yeaZe6